Which type of cartilage composes the part of the rib that makes the sternochondral joint?

The part of the rib that makes the sternochondral joint is composed of costal cartilage. Costal cartilage is a type of hyaline cartilage that extends from the rib and attaches to the sternum, either directly or indirectly. It provides for the attachment of most ribs to the sternum.
